In general, you should clean your treadmill each time you use it. Dirt, sweat and grime are the main enemies of a treadmill in operation, and can lead to permanent damage if not dealt with quickly. You'll notice that your treadmill will last longer if you maintain regular cleaning. The manual for your treadmill should detail the specific steps to follow. However generally, you should clean the motor deck and any electronic components.
It is also necessary to make sure that your deck is regularly lubricated, particularly if you use it frequently. This reduces the amount of friction that could cause damage to the deck. The user manual will provide more information.
For storage, it is recommended to store your treadmill in a climate-controlled area when it's not utilized. This will stop rust or mold from accumulating on the machine and make it easier to clean. Some fold-in treadmills have safety features that are built-in to help prevent injuries or accidents during your workout. Certain treadmills have an emergency stop-clip integrated into them that shuts off the belt in case you fall or trip over. Some have sensors that can detect movement and automatically slow down the running belt if you're not paying attention to your surroundings.
